💥 Episode Summary

Your planner doesn’t know your hormones. Your calendar doesn’t account for crash days. And your rigid routine? It only works on fantasy-you, not real-you. In this Functioning-ish deep dive, Jen breaks down how to actually build systems that hold when your brain doesn’t—by designing around your energy, attention, and nervous system capacity.

She shares the behind-the-scenes of how launching this podcast taught her to flex, pause, and recalibrate—on purpose. Then she walks you through practical strategies like MVP Menus, energy mapping, 70% capacity design, and shame-free backup plans.

This isn’t about doing more—it’s about doing it smarter. Flexible structure is the strategy.

🧠 What You’ll Learn

  • Why your calendar is lying to you (and how to fix it)
  • How to design your day around energy, not just tasks
  • What MVP Menus are—and why they’re ADHD gold
  • The power of built-in recovery time (and how to use it)
  • How to plan at 70% capacity (not 110%)
  • What to do when your day goes sideways (without shame)

🔧 Tools & Frameworks Mentioned

  • MVP Menus (Minimum Viable Productivity for low, mid, and high energy days)
  • Energy Mapping (Use your natural peaks to drive your day)
  • Plan B Systems (Design for the off days—not just your ideal ones)
  • Capacity-Based Planning (Structure that bends, not breaks)
